added auto=count(targetchooser)
and countedamount wparsed int
they work together for cards where it is difficult to get working without knowing in advance how many we had ie: exile blah creatures, for each creature you exiled do effect.
auto=count(creature|mybattlefield)
auto=moveto(exile)
auto=draw:countedamount
it takes into account token creatures, which our old methods did not.

added abilities:
proliferate
ProliferateChooser:new targetchooser for cards with counter and poison counters "proliferation".
MenuAbility:new internal ability to create custom menus of abilities which can be activated in sequence one after another.
multikicker, syntax kicker=multi{b}
works with variable word "kicked", the amount of times it was kicked.
target=<number>tc,target=<upto:>tc,target=<anyamount>tc,target(<number>tc),target(<upto:>tc),target(<anynumber>tc);
multitarget is now supported with the exception of "devided any way you choose" which can not be supported becuase we allow detoggling of targeted cards with a "second" click....so you can not click the same card 2 times to add it to the targets list twice for example.
this is minor, as the bulk of multitarget is not "devided"
removed 's' parsing for multitarget, added a limit of 1000 to "unlimited" for easier handling; we currently can't handle activation of an ability on a 1000 cards very well on any platform(infact i don't suggest it)
Countershroud(counterstring), this MTGAbility allows you to denote that a card can not have counters of the type "counterstring" put on it.
"any" is for no counters allowed at all. this is a replacement effect. cards state that they can still be the targets of counter effects, however on resolve nothing is placed on them instead.
@counteradded(counterstring) from(target):,@counterremoved(counterstring) from(target):: these are triggers for cards which state "whenever you add a counter of "counterstring" to "target"; added counterEvents struct;

taught ai how to use multi-mana producers such as birds and duel lands by adding a method for it to find it's mana for a payment. it can effectively use cards like birds of paradise and sol ring(without locking up). It's primary method of pMana searching was maintain for performance(no need to deep search if we have it in pMana).
added a vector to actionlayer to store mana abilities for pMana. this provides us with a dramatic improvement when mana lords are present by reducing the amount of objects that need checking when ai checks pMana.
with 80 mana objects and a ton of lords one instance i checked went from 8000ish checks down to 80<===big difference.

-- zipFS has several limitations...
--- in a general way, seekg doesn't work... so getting a file's size needs to be done through JFileSystem.
--- getLine on files open with zipFS doesn't work so great. Not sure if it is a normal issue because files are open in binary or not... JFileSystem therefore offers a "readIntoString" function that needs to be used instead of the usual "getline" technique. However getLine can then be used on a stream connected to the string.
